PDA

Показать полную графическую версию : [решено] Не создается дамп памяти при стопе


Страниц : [1] 2 3 4

Petya V4sechkin
10-04-2008, 17:53
Почему может не создаваться дамп памяти

В дополнение к статье KB130536 (http://support.microsoft.com/kb/130536) читаем Windows Hang and Crash Dump Analysis (https://1drv.ms/u/s!Au66isdNRnAylPcE-8eRnls4tRJ3Rw) (Вебкаст (http://msevents.microsoft.com/cui/WebCastEventDetails.aspx?culture=en-US&EventID=1032298076&CountryCode=US)):
Почему не создается дамп?
Файл подкачки на загрузочном томе слишком мал (установите размер по выбору системы)

1. Нажмите сочетание клавиш http://res1.windows.microsoft.com/resbox/en/Windows%20Vista/Main/0/c/0c970446-1432-4ea7-b578-67cc2b5844ae/0c970446-1432-4ea7-b578-67cc2b5844ae.png+Pause (где это? (http://tools.oszone.net/Vadikan/img/winpause.png))

2. [в Windows 7 и Vista] Щелкните ссылку Дополнительные параметры системы.

2. В разделе Быстродействие нажмите кнопку Параметры, перейдите на вкладку Дополнительно и в разделе Виртуальная память нажмите кнопку Изменить. В открывшемся окне установите флажок, как показано на рисунке ниже.

http://tools.oszone.net/Vadikan/img/pagefile-auto.png
Недостаточно свободного пространства на диске для записи дампа (настройте (http://forum.oszone.net/thread-93436.html) запись малых дампов памяти)
Критическая ошибка возникает до открытия файла подкачки. Например, ошибка во время инициализации драйвера.
Поврежденные компоненты вовлечены в процесс создания дампа
Спонтанная перезагрузка
Зависание системы

P. S. Надо будет эту презентацию вдоль и поперек поштудировать.
P. P. S. Интересная шутка на 58-й странице )

lookback
10-04-2008, 20:05
Vadikan, в журнале появляется только одна запись в колонке "Приложения":
Тип события: Уведомление
Источник события: Winlogon
Категория события: Отсутствует
Код события: 1001
Дата: 10.04.2008
Время: 18:42:15
Пользователь: Н/Д
Компьютер:
Описание:
Checking file system on C:
The type of the file system is NTFS.
Volume label is System.


A disk check has been scheduled.
Windows will now check the disk.
Cleaning up 2 unused index entries from index $SII of file 0x9.
Cleaning up 2 unused index entries from index $SDH of file 0x9.
Cleaning up 2 unused security descriptors.

20482843 KB total disk space.
9135884 KB in 107016 files.
28876 KB in 3233 indexes.
0 KB in bad sectors.
177823 KB in use by the system.
65536 KB occupied by the log file.
11140260 KB available on disk.

4096 bytes in each allocation unit.
5120710 total allocation units on disk.
2785065 allocation units available on disk.

Internal Info:
10 b0 01 00 b4 ae 01 00 6d e9 01 00 00 00 00 00 ........m.......
bc 00 00 00 00 00 00 00 8e 03 00 00 00 00 00 00 ................
52 ee 2a 08 00 00 00 00 9c d3 c3 0d 00 00 00 00 R.*.............
f2 13 51 08 00 00 00 00 00 00 00 00 00 00 00 00 ..Q.............
00 00 00 00 00 00 00 00 50 95 0c 22 00 00 00 00 ........P.."....
c0 79 fc 6e 00 00 00 00 a8 3a 07 00 08 a2 01 00 .y.n.....:......
00 00 00 00 00 30 9c 2d 02 00 00 00 a1 0c 00 00 .....0.-........

Windows has finished checking your disk.
Please wait while your computer restarts.

Это все, остальные новые в колонке "Система", и по-моему не относятся к делу: "Уведомление. Служба журнала событий остановлена...", "Уведомление. Запущена служба журнала событий...", "Уведомление. Служба "Службы терминалов" перешла в состояние Работает..." и т. п.

Vadikan
10-04-2008, 23:30
lookback, журнал событий ничего не проясняет... Поскольку вы уже выполнили "домашнюю работу", у меня особых идей нет. Попробуйте следующее:
1. Отключить все устройства, без которых возможна загрузка системы (модемы, оптические приводы, и т. д.)
2. Привести все службы к конфигурации по умолчанию http://www.oszone.net/2517/
3. Сменить блок питания, если возможно.

Drinko
11-04-2008, 00:40
Доктор Ватсон не включен (http://technet.microsoft.com/ru-ru/library/aa995634.aspx)

lookback
11-04-2008, 17:02
Vadikan, при возможности попробую варианты. Если получится решить проблему, отпишусь.

Drinko, dr watson всегда включен и настроен сохранять дамп, только мне кажется, что здесь он ни при чем, т. к. для него задаются собственные настройки, которые могут отличаться от настроек "отказ системы": путь для сохранения дампа, записывать ли событие в системный журнал и т. д.
Но в любом случае, дампов от ватсона также не обнаружено.

Спасибо всем, кто помогает.

Drinko
11-04-2008, 18:37
Приведите эти ветки реестра:
[H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ows NT\CurrentVersion\AeDebug]
[H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\CrashControl]
После проверки раздела C:\ с параметром /F (при старте Windows) »
т.е. в текстовом режиме, до логона?

lookback
16-04-2008, 00:39
"Приведите эти ветки реестра:
[H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ows NT\CurrentVersion\AeDebug]
[H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\CrashControl]
[H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ows NT\CurrentVersion\AeDebug]
"Auto"=dword:00000001
"Debugger"="drwtsn32 -p %ld -e %ld -g"
"UserDebuggerHotKey"=dword:00000000

Раздел: H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\CrashControl
Название класса: <Класс отсутствует>
Последнее время записи:
Параметр 0
Название: AutoReboot
Тип: REG_DWORD
Значение: 0x0
Параметр 1
Название: DumpFile
Тип: REG_EXPAND_SZ
Значение: C:\MEMORY.DMP
Параметр 2
Название: MinidumpDir
Тип: REG_EXPAND_SZ
Значение: C:\
Параметр 3
Название: Overwrite
Тип: REG_DWORD
Значение: 0x1
Параметр 4
Название: SendAlert
Тип: REG_DWORD
Значение: 0x0
Параметр 5
Название: CrashDumpEnabled
Тип: REG_DWORD
Значение: 0x3
Параметр 6
Название: LogEvent
Тип: REG_DWORD
Значение: 0x1
Параметр 7
Название: AutoReboot
Тип: REG_DWORD
Значение: 0x0


т.е. в текстовом режиме до логона?
Да, до логона.


Petya V4sechkin, спасибо за ссылку на интересную книгу.


P.S.: На днях разработчики уверили, что баг исправлен в новой версии, осталось только дождаться этой новой версии :)
Тесты прекращаются.


Спасибо всем кто помогал :up:

Drinko
16-04-2008, 02:42
Примените:

Windows Registry Editor Version 5.00

[H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\CrashControl]
"AutoReboot"=dword:00000000
"CrashDumpEnabled"=dword:00000003
"DumpFile"=hex(2):25,00,53,00,79,00,73,00,74,00,65,00,6d,00,52,00,6f,00,6f,00,\
74,00,25,00,5c,00,4d,00,45,00,4d,00,4f,00,52,00,59,00,2e,00,44,00,4d,00,50,\
00,00,00
"LogEvent"=dword:00000001
"MinidumpDir"=hex(2):25,00,53,00,79,00,73,00,74,00,65,00,6d,00,52,00,6f,00,6f,\
00,74,00,25,00,5c,00,4d,00,69,00,6e,00,69,00,64,00,75,00,6d,00,70,00,00,00
"Overwrite"=dword:00000001
"SendAlert"=dword:00000001

endru2006
23-01-2009, 20:30
Кто поможет? Не записываются данные в файл при появлении синего экрана. настроил все, как написано на форуме, но файлы не создаются.

Blast
23-01-2009, 23:33
настроил все, как написано на форуме »
пошагово и дословно что именно настраивали? файл подкачки какого размера указан?

endru2006
24-01-2009, 15:56
В настройках системы указал чтобы ошибки писались в малый дамп (64кб), отключил автоматическую перезагрузку при ошибке... в результате синее окно висит, а в файл инфа не пишется. хотел узнать какой драйвер в системе глючит...

система Windows XP SP3

endru2006
24-01-2009, 16:26
файл подкачки на диске С отсутствует

Vadikan
24-01-2009, 19:07
файл подкачки на диске С отсутствует »
Если C - системный диск, то дамп создаваться не будет. Приведите полную конфигурацию компьютера, включая расклад по жестким дискам и их разделам (скриншот diskmgmt.msc).

endru2006
25-01-2009, 09:28
да, он системный.
подскажите, как создать скрин, забыл

Vadikan
25-01-2009, 13:38
подскажите, как создать скрин, забыл »
http://wiki.oszone.net/index.php/Скриншот

Просто создайте файл подкачки на системном диске. Если у вас файл подкачки на другом разделе этого же физического диска - это не имеет смысла. Уберите оттуда и создайте на C. Если он на другом физическом диске, создайте на C файл подкачки минимального размера. Ссылка по теме Как переместить файл подкачки в Microsoft Windows XP (http://support.microsoft.com/kb/307886/). См. также разъяснения по поводу размещения файла подкачки в статье OSzone.net: Как переместить файл подкачки в Windows Vista (http://www.oszone.net/7679/)

endru2006
25-01-2009, 14:31
если я правильно понял, после создания файла подкачки на диске С, малый дамп памяти будет писаться на диск? Если да, то СПАСИБО!

Vadikan
25-01-2009, 14:37
если я правильно понял, после создания файла подкачки на диске С, малый дамп памяти будет писаться на диск? »
Да, я уже сказал файл подкачки на диске С отсутствует »
Если C - системный диск, то дамп создаваться не будет.

endru2006
25-01-2009, 15:07
Спасибо!

giv5dot26
11-02-2009, 17:50
Доброе время суток. Позволил себе создать тему, если надо ткните носом в ссылку. При запуске программы AISuite (ASUS - управление энергосбережением и прочее) комп выпадает в СТОП 0x00000124 я очень хотел создать и посмотреть дамп но создать его не могу. Файл подкачки на диске С (системный) - 100Мб - я грешу на малый его размер. Другой файл подкачки не на системном диске - 1700Мб. Галочки все стоят, путь к файлу дампа указан отличный от дефолтного. Дамп не создается. Подскажите.

Frialannon
03-07-2009, 13:58
такая же проблема. Раньше всё создавалось нормально. Теперь когда вылетает BSOD дамп не хочет создавать. Автозагрузку выключил жду но ничего проитсходит. Что делать хелп!?




© OSzone.net 2001-2012